Fed decision, crude oil and global cues likely to drive stock market next week

Investors should brace for a volatile week ahead as global markets react to the Federal Reserve's latest policy decision and fluctuating crude oil prices. These key macro factors will heavily influence market sentiment, potentially driving significant moves across major indices and sectors.
For Indian investors, this external backdrop is critical. A dovish Fed stance or stable oil prices could boost risk appetite, while hawkish signals or geopolitical tensions might trigger a sell-off. Domestic stocks will likely follow these global cues closely, making it a week to watch for broader market trends.
Moving forward, traders should monitor the Fed's economic outlook and crude oil inventories. These indicators will provide clarity on the market's direction. Keeping a close eye on global cues will be essential for navigating the upcoming trading sessions effectively.
